In a not-so-distant future where society has changed considerably but the problems often remain the same, a young policewoman from Paris is dragged into a difficult, dangerous investigation that could impact the very future of mankind.

Brazilian artist Leo is best known for his science-fiction, multi-series saga The Worlds of Aldebaran. He also created Canadian Mountie Trent as well as Kenya and its second season Namibia, all three with Rodolphe. Belgian author Corine Jamar has written children’s books, novels, and several BDs such as Les Filles d’Aphrodite. Fred Simon is a long time comics fan and professional artist; among his series are adaptations of Jack London’s Call of the Wild and Robert Louis Stevenson’s Treasure Island.
